Alex Ovechkin: 50 goals, one game remaining
Steven Stamkos: 50 goals, one game remaining
Sidney Crosby: 49 goals, one game remaining
Steven Stamkos scored twice tonight against the Florida Panthers, doing just about what I expected as he put up 10 shots on goal, and also was able to get an assist as well. Here’s video of his two goals:
This sets up a very interesting final game of the season, as Crosby, Ovechkin and Stamkos have just one game remaining and neither have anything to play for other than the scoring lead. Expect their teams to be feeding them the puck as much as possible, and I’ll be disappointed if we don’t see an average of 8 shots between the three players.
You could say that Ovechkin has the disadvantage, as it’s likely he goes against Tuukka Rask tomorrow on NBC’s Game of the Week. Of course, with Boston securing their playoff appearance from earlier today, the Bruins could put Tim Thomas in net.
